18th Century French Commode

About the Item

A superb high quality 18th century French rococo bombe shaped commode - in oak with two deep drawers in a faux marble painted finish with a beautiful real shaped marble top - the metal decorations and handles appear to be bronze - the chest and marble are offered in very good condition - this chest is not to be confused with 19th European bombe commodes it is very high quality construction - there is a engraved furniture makers or possibly owners mark on the chest beneath the marble which shows in the last photo - so far I have not been able to identify the mark - there are two pretty keys
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 30.5 in (77.47 cm)Width: 37 in (93.98 cm)Depth: 17.5 in (44.45 cm)
